>>>>> On Wed, 12 Feb 2014, Samuli Suominen wrote:

> USE="gtk3" is valid only for libraries when it's not easy to
> split/slot as a temporary flag. Applications should simply pick one,
> the latest one that works, since anything else is obviously
> redudant.

I don't see why applications should be treated differently from
libraries. If a program supports more than one toolkit, then the
choice should be left to the user. Nothing redundant there.
